Both drives are designed to make SATA-based systems feel more responsive than they do with mechanical hard drives, and reviews for both describe faster startup and application loading. The S101Q has the edge on the supplied performance score and listed specifications, with up to 560MB/s read and 490MB/s write compared with the S101's up-to-550MB/s read and 450MB/s media speed. The real-world difference may be modest in ordinary desktop use, but the S101Q is the better-supported choice on the available data.
The S101Q wins the speed comparison on both provided scoring and listed figures. It is rated for up to 560MB/s read and 490MB/s write, while the S101 is rated for up to 550MB/s read with 450MB/s media speed. Both remain SATA drives, so their performance ceiling is determined by the SATA interface rather than the much higher potential speeds associated with NVMe storage.

Both products are listed for Windows, Linux, and Mac OS on compatible laptops, desktops, and all-in-one computers. The S101Q adds explicit backward compatibility with SATA II and SATA interfaces and earns a much higher compatibility score. Buyers should not treat either product as universally compatible: confirm that the computer has a 2.5-inch SATA bay and connector, rather than an M.2-only or NVMe-only storage arrangement.
Both drives connect through SATA 6Gb/s and require an appropriate internal SATA connection or a compatible external SATA enclosure. The S101Q has the stronger connectivity and compatibility scores and explicitly states backward compatibility with SATA II and SATA interfaces. The S101 supports SATA-600 and is listed for Windows, Linux, and Mac OS, but reviews include more reports of the drive not being recognized. The S101Q is the safer pick where broad interface compatibility is the priority.
